Output 2fd63e54e8885e91f29ad92026255e72057f32c5da325c05caf85f8af42c7d18:1
- value
- 23390318
- script pubkey
- OP_0 OP_PUSHBYTES_20 efe38f7926d53bed61a4219208aa6244d5dee3fb
- address
- bc1qal3c77fx65a76cdyyxfq32nzgn2aaclmthmmwq
- transaction
- 2fd63e54e8885e91f29ad92026255e72057f32c5da325c05caf85f8af42c7d18